1) Start with the canisters. Find what is easy for you to find and purchase and then purchase at least 3 for each person/mask you want to protect. If the mask is part of a bug out or exfil strategy 1 canister may be sufficient but if the mask is part of a bunker down and shelter in place strategy then 3 canisters is the absolute minimum. Some thing that takes NATO canisters is probably the best idea.
2) Make sure all your masks use the same canisters.
3) Typically the difference between a inexpensive mask and an expensive mask is the level of visibility they afford and how obstructed your view is. This really comes down to a simple question: Do you think you will need to fire a rifle? The bottom of the market is the israeli gas mask which can be found for around $30. These do the job but if you put one on, pick up a rifle and try to get a sight picture and you will see what I am talking about.
4) A water canteen kit or Hydration kit is nice to have and comes down to questions of how long do you think you will be in it and how much physical exertion do you think you will do in it?

Sure, most current NATO gas masks are fairly comfortable and the canister lifespan is about 6 to 8 hours. However, if you're considering a gas mask, you should also look into a military chem-suit with active charcoal, gloves and rubber boots. Most chemical weapons can permeate the skin and that's the thing to be concerned about. You'll also want to have neutralizing agents and cleansers that can be used to clean the chemical agents off you without spreading them to others.
edit: Oh yea. If you're a guy, remember to shave regularly to ensure you get the best seal from your mask.
